From 29 June to 10 July 2026, a delegation of five students from Ho Chi Minh City University of Technology and Engineering (HCM-UTE) proudly participated in the "AUN–UBD Summer Camp 2026," hosted by Universiti Brunei Darussalam (UBD) in collaboration with the ASEAN University Network (AUN).

Centering on "Tides of Tomorrow: Reimagining Coastal Cities," the 10-day program gathered ASEAN youth delegates to explore innovative solutions for sustainable coastal development.
🌟 Program Highlights:
- Academic Excellence: Engaged in expert lectures on marine biodiversity, blue urbanism, nature-based carbon sinks, and circular aquaculture economies.
- Youth Leadership: Contributed to the Future Ocean Changemakers Youth Forum, proposing strategic ideas for the Blue Economy and ocean sustainability.

- Practical Insights: Conducted field visits to key maritime hubs, including Muara Port Company, Department of Fisheries, Royal Brunei Navy, and Brunei Gas Carriers.
- Cultural Exchange: Proudly promoted Vietnamese culture and strengthened regional ties through international networking sessions.
This experience not only enhanced our students' global perspective and critical skills but also demonstrated HCMUTE’s commitment to regional integration and sustainable innovation.
